Reauthorization Program Guidance Letters (R-PGLs)

R-PGLs communicate provisions in reauthorization acts that impact Airports' programs. The FAA Reauthorization Act of 2024 (P.L. 118-63) and the FAA Reauthorization Act of 2018 (P.L. 115-254) included numerous changes to statutes and other authorizing acts governing the operations and administration of multiple programs under the Office of Airports (ARP or Airports).

Note: Provisions requiring further implementation may not be available immediately. The Office of Airports encourages users to sign up for notifications to receive announcements when the content on this page is updated. Additional guidance on other sections in reauthorization acts may be issued by the Office of Airport Safety and Standards and the Office of Airport Compliance and Management Analysis, as applicable.
